Assigning Default Values / Answers to Custom Workflow Questions

Last Updated: Friday, June 17th 2022

Having set up some questions on your workflow you can make the answer boxes default to values if required.... 


@@job/attribute/SignName Personnel Name (e.g. Engineer / Driver)
@@job/column/notes    This will pull through the notes entered when creating the job
@@job/attribute/JQ-{external reference of the job question] This will pull through the value from a job question
@@personnel/question/{external ref of field} Value from custom question in personnel (Entity Question)
@@customer/question/{external ref of field}  
@@site/question/{external ref of field}  
@@contact/question/{external ref of field}  
 These two will allow you to record time to next destination within the main workflow (and make it mandatory if reqd) rather than asking at the end of the job (which is optional)
Todays date / time
@@cmd/calendar/edit/+ 6 months

This example sets a date field to 6 months on from current date

@@cmd/calendar/edit/+ 6 months, - 1 day, and so on

You need to make sure each change is separated by a comma and a space: (", ") otherwise the code wont be able to split it out and will get confused. It doesn't matter if you specify "day" or "days" as it will do the same thing anyway.

Typically used with a Numeric Textbox question on arrival tab to record mileage to site.  Using this default value setting will also make this appear on the Time Review page if enabled.
Use this on a numeric textbox on the Time Review tab and it will auto-total the mileages as per above
If used with a date/time question, the value filled in will set the date complete column on Motivity jobs
Use this to generate a unique number - e.g for a certificate.
You need to add a system_data question (which is hidden on the app) and set the default value to be @@system/unique_question_number_value.
There is a system setting "Unique Question Number Value" that you can use to set or alter the next number used.
